The weather is bouncing around and my body is feeling it. One side affect of not exercising is increased pain, so I can only blame myself. Arthritis and fibromyalgia pain is reduced with continued exercise (especially strength training) which I have been neglecting. I did do 30 min of a TRX workout with a couple breaks but back doing it the easiest ways. I've met my goals here today-- now to get a few household chores done.
